Symmetry Soundsystem Launch Event

 

16 Mar 2010

 

 



When a sound engineer and an experienced festival organiser put their heads, time and money together to build a custom dance rig, you know the results are going to be worth hearing.

They've created a 25K system that Spesh, one half of Symmetry Soundsystem, says "has been designed and engineered from the top down for bass heavy dance music."

It comprises of eight custom built Labhorns, and four 18" dual kick bins to deliver "thunderous sub and pounding kicks", as well as Turbo Sound Floodlight tops, an industry standard box installed in many of the worlds top venues.

To launch the system they're hosting a night at Peckham's Bussey Building on March 26th with a line-up that includes Cyantific, Instra:mental, Engine Earz (live), Dokkabi Q, Pdex and Flawless amongst others.

Sam Coad, otherwise known as Josh X, says they were keen to find a line-up that would push the system in different directions. "We're really pleased with the line-up we've got, a lot of the performers were really keen to work with us when we explained about the event which was great."
